AI Labyrinth: Outsmarting Unauthorized Crawlers with Decoy Web Pages

Cloudflare has introduced an inventive approach to AI security, using decoy web pages to protect valuable content from unauthorized crawling. Instead of simply blocking unwanted bots—which can tip off attackers—this new tool creates a maze of AI-generated pages that mimic real content. The result is a resource-draining distraction for malicious bots while genuine visitors see only the intended material.

How Cloudflare Uses AI for Cybersecurity

At the heart of this system is Cloudflare’s Workers AI combined with an open-source model. This duo pre-generates realistic, sanitized pages that look virtually identical to authentic content. The generated decoy pages are seamlessly integrated into the web experience without affecting site structure or SEO rankings. In effect, it’s like handing a would-be intruder a map with endless dead ends.

“While Cloudflare has several tools for identifying and blocking unauthorized AI crawling, we have found that blocking malicious bots can alert the attacker that you are on to them, leading to a shift in approach, and a never-ending arms race.”

This proactive diversion strategy also tracks click patterns, acting as a honeypot to monitor suspicious behavior. With nearly 50 billion requests passing through its network daily, Cloudflare recognized that a nuanced, adaptive defense was needed instead of blunt force methods like CAPTCHA or IP blocking.

Long-Term Implications and Challenges

As innovative as the AI Labyrinth is, its long-term success will depend on adapting to an evolving threat landscape. Attackers may eventually develop ways to spot the decoy pages, which calls for constant updates and refinements to the system. However, by shifting from traditional blocking to strategic diversion, Cloudflare is raising the bar for unauthorized crawler defenses in the realm of AI security.

This method represents a shift in cybersecurity philosophy: instead of erecting barriers that may be circumvented, businesses now invest in misdirection tactics that waste attackers’ resources. The approach underlines the broader trend of using advanced algorithms and deceptive techniques to counter increasingly sophisticated digital threats.
